    1. Add all ingredients to a medium sized bowl
    2. Mix until well combined (mixture should be thick and sticky)
    3. Cover a baking sheet with parchment paper and add apprx. 16 equal sized cookies to the tray (I used a normal sized cookie scoop)
    4. Bake at 350 Degrees | 177 Celsius for around 10 minutes

    1. In a large bowl, whisk together the oats,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
    2. In a medium bowl, combine the peanut butter, egg, vanilla, and honey. Whisk until blended.
    3. Scrape the liquid mixture into the oat mixture and stir just until combined. The dough will be wet and sticky. Fold in the chocolate chips. Place in the refrigerator and let chill for at least 30 minutes or up to 3 days.
    4. When ready to bake, place a rack in the center of your oven and pre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line a large r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one baking sheet. Remove the dough from the refrigerator (if it is very stiff, you may need to let it sit out for 5 to 10 minutes). With a cookie scoop or spoon, drop the dough into 2-inch balls and arrange on the baking sheet, leaving 1 inch of space around each. With your fingers, gently flatten each cookie to be about 3/4-inch thick.
